× my parents encouraged me to share my toes with my little brother
✓ my parents encouraged me to share my toys with my little brother
The word 'toes' is incorrect in this context; it should be 'toys' because sharing toes is illogical, while sharing toys is a common activity among siblings.
× People mostly don't like to share their cars together
✓ People mostly don't like to share their cars
The phrase 'share their cars together' is redundant because 'share' already implies 'together'; removing 'together' improves clarity and correctness.
